Computer Checks
Computer checks, also known as laser checks, are a type of check that is printed directly from computers. They are made to be compatible with check printing software and a laser printer. The software lets you easily alter the design and format, which makes it an efficient and cost-effective way to print checks. Computer checks allow the ability to create check prints for all accounts and print multiple checks at the same time making it easier to save time and energy compared to writing checks by hand.

Laser Checks
Laser checks are a form of computer check that is printed with a laser printer. They are similar to computer checks in that they are customizable using check printing software, however, they also have added security features such as watermarks, security screens, and ink that is heat-sensitive. Laser checks are a great option for businesses who wish to make sure their check is secure and difficult to forge.
